Übersicht über SharePoint Foundation und den Volumeschattenkopie-Dienst

Letzte Änderung: Donnerstag, 29. Juli 2010

Gilt für: SharePoint Foundation 2010

Für Sicherungsanbieter wird durch den Volumeschattenkopie-Dienst (Volume Shadow Copy Service, VSS) das Sichern von Microsoft-Serverlösungen mit einer zentralisierten API vereinfacht. Microsoft SharePoint Foundation enthält einen referenziellen VSS Writer (nachfolgend "SPF-VSS Writer" genannt), der in das Windows VSS-Sicherungsframework integriert ist. Dadurch wird das Sichern und Wiederherstellen von SharePoint Foundation-Daten durch Sicherungsanwendungen ermöglicht. Es wird ein Überschreibungsszenario mit schwerwiegenden Folgen für die gesamte Farm (einschließlich Suchindex) unterstützt. Bei der Wiederherstellung werden Datenbanken eingebunden und Websitezuordnungen synchronisiert.

In der folgenden Abbildung sind die wichtigsten Komponenten im System dargestellt: Microsoft Windows Server 2008 (und der Volumeschattenkopie-Dienst), SharePoint Foundation (und der SPF-VSS Writer für den Volumeschattenkopie-Dienst in Windows Server 2008) und die Sicherungs-/Wiederherstellungsanwendung eines Drittanbieters (oder eine benutzerdefinierte Anwendung) (einschließlich des Anforderers und des Anbieters).

Beziehungen zwischen SharePoint und VSS

Der VSS kommuniziert mit dem Dateisystem von Windows Server 2008 und mit dem Massenspeicher-Gerätetreiber über einen Anbieter eines Drittanbieters (oder über einen benutzerdefinierten Anbieter). Der Hardwareanbieter muss bestimmen, wo die Schattenkopie erstellt wird. Die hardwarespezifische Schattenkopie wird vom VSS abstrahiert, sodass die Sicherungs-/Wiederherstellungsanwendung einheitlich auf die Schattenkopie zugreifen kann, ohne die Einzelheiten der Hardwareimplementierung zu kennen.

Der SharePoint Foundation-Speicher ist eine Komponente von SharePoint Foundation und greift auf SharePoint Foundation-Speichergruppen über das Dateisystem von Windows Server 2008 zu. Innerhalb des Dateisystems schließt jede SharePoint Foundation-Speichergruppe die Konfiguration, den Inhalt, die Suchdatenbanken und alle Datenbanken von Drittanbietern ein, die in der Konfigurationsdatenbank und in den Suchindexdateien registriert sind. Ebenfalls enthalten sind Dienste, die auf dem Service Application Framework von SharePoint Foundation aufbauen.

Zur Unterstützung des VSS enthält SharePoint Foundation den SPF-VSS Writer. Der SPF-VSS Writer wird mit dem SharePoint Foundation-Speicher (der im Auftrag des Anforderers betrieben wird) koordiniert, um die Speichergruppe zu sperren und deren Bereitstellung aufzuheben, bevor sie gesichert wird. Nach Abschluss der Sicherung wird dann die Sperrung der Speichergruppe aufgehoben und die Speichergruppe bereitgestellt.

Während einer Wiederherstellung wird der SPF-VSS Writer von der Sicherungs-/Wiederherstellungsanwendung in Koordinierung mit dem SharePoint Foundation-Speicher (der im Auftrag des Anforderers betrieben wird) angewiesen, die Bereitstellung der Speichergruppe aufzuheben, die Datenbankdateien zu ersetzen und die Speichergruppe wieder bereitzustellen.

HinweisHinweis

Wichtige Informationen zur Wiederherstellung finden Sie unter "Wiederherstellung" in VSS-Anforderer und SharePoint Foundation.

Als Anforderer wird eine Anwendung eines Drittanbieters (oder benutzerdefinierte Anwendung) bezeichnet, die den VSS zum ordnungsgemäßen Sichern und Wiederherstellen von SharePoint Foundation-Daten verwendet. Der Anforderer kommunizierte mit dem VSS, um Informationen zu SharePoint Foundation anzufordern, die Erstellung von Schattenkopien zu veranlassen und Zugriff auf die Daten für die Sicherung zu erhalten.

Bei der Wiederherstellung kommuniziert der Anforderer zudem mit dem VSS, um das System auf den Wiederherstellungsvorgang vorzubereiten und um die Daten anschließend wieder auf dem Massenspeichergerät zu speichern. Die Sicherungs-/Wiederherstellungsanwendung ist auch für die Verwendung von Windows Server 2008 zum Lesen von Daten aus und Schreiben von Daten auf das Sicherungsspeichermedium verantwortlich, gleich ob es sich dabei um ein Bandarchiv, ein Storage Area Network oder ein anderes Sicherungsmedium handelt.

Die Informationen, die zum erfolgreichen Ausführen von Sicherungs- und Wiederherstellungsvorgängen mit SharePoint Foundation, dem VSS und der Sicherungs-/Wiederherstellungsanwendung erforderlich sind, werden als Teil der SPF-VSS Writer-Metadaten übertragen.

Die Abfolge oberster Ebene von Ergebnissen während der Sicherungs- und Wiederherstellungsvorgänge lautet wie folgt:

  1. Vom Sicherungsprogramm (oder Agent) wird ein geplanter Auftrag ausgeführt.

  2. Der VSS-Anforderer in der Sicherungs-/Wiederherstellungsanwendung sendet einen Befehl zum Erstellen einer Schattenkopie der ausgewählten SharePoint Foundation-Speichergruppen an den VSS.

  3. Der VSS kommuniziert mit dem SPF-VSS Writer, um eine Momentaufnahmensicherung vorzubereiten. SharePoint Foundation lässt Verwaltungsaktionen an der Speichergruppe nicht zu, überprüft Volumeabhängigkeiten und hält alle Schreibvorgänge in Datenbank- und Transaktionsprotokolldateien an, während Nur-Lese-Zugriff erteilt wird.

  4. Der VSS kommuniziert mit dem entsprechenden Speicheranbieter, damit eine Schattenkopie des Speichervolumes erstellt wird, das die SharePoint Foundation-Speichergruppe enthält.

  5. Der VSS gibt SharePoint Foundation frei, um die normalen Vorgänge fortzusetzen.

  6. Der VSS-Anforderer überprüft die Integrität des Sicherungssatzes, bevor der Erfolg der Sicherung angezeigt wird. Die Zeit der letzten Datenbanksicherung wird von SharePoint Foundation erfasst.